perf intel-pt: Add support for decoding FUP/TIP only
Use the new itrace 'q' option to add support for a mode of decoding that ignores TNT, does not walk object code, but gets the ip from FUP and TIP packets. Example: $ perf record -e intel_pt//u grep -rI pudding drivers [ perf record: Woken up 52 times to write data ] [ perf record: Captured and wrote 57.870 MB perf.data ] $ time perf script --itrace=bi | wc -l 58948289 real 1m23.863s user 1m23.251s sys 0m7.452s $ time perf script --itrace=biq | wc -l 3385694 real 0m4.453s user 0m4.455s sys 0m0.328s Signed-off-by: Adrian Hunter <adrian.hunter@intel.com> Reviewed-by: Andi Kleen <ak@linux.intel.com> Tested-by: Arnaldo Carvalho de Melo <acme@redhat.com> Cc: Jiri Olsa <jolsa@redhat.com> Link: http://lore.kernel.org/lkml/20200710151104.15137-12-adrian.hunter@intel.com Signed-off-by: Arnaldo Carvalho de Melo <acme@redhat.com>
